Futurism is an avant-garde art and social movement that originated in Italy in the early 20th century. Futurist movement highlighted the dynamic, speed, energy, and force of machines and the vigor, change, and restlessness of the modern world. The representation of motion and speed is a distinctive feature of futurist art.

Futurism, early 20th-century artistic movement centred in Italy that emphasized the dynamism, speed, energy, and power of the machine and the vitality, change, and restlessness of modern life. During the second decade of the 20th century, the movement's influence radiated outward across most of Europe, most significantly to the Russian avant-garde. . The most-significant results of the.

Futurism is an Avant-garde art and social movement that originated in Italy. The key document for the development of Futurism is the Manifesto of Futurism, which was published by Filippo Tommaso Marinetti in 1909.. Futurism developed in literature as well as in painting, sculpture, architecture, industrial design, music, film, dance, and.

40'H x 8'W x 8'D. Location. Pier 14, San Francisco, California, United States. Created by Nathaniel Taylor, Sean Orlando, and David Shulman, the Raygun Gothic Rocketship is a Retro Futuristic art sculpture originally produced for the 2009 Burning Man Festival as an art installation in the Black Rock Desert of Nevada.
